David Crosby has already apologized for his disrespectful tweet about Eddie Van Halen shortly after the legendary rocker’s death at the age of 65. He was asked by a fan about his thoughts on EVH and Crosby responded with, “Meh…”

He followed it up by declaring that “Hendrix changed the world of guitar. Nobody else really …look I get it ..many of you loved Van Halen ….and the one time I met he was nice ….and he was talented …meh to me means I don’t care that much ….and I don’t …doesn’t mean he wasn’t good, he was but not for me.”

After receiving backlash from fans and fellow rockers like Twisted Sister’s Dee Snider, he clarified that “Nobody else really …look I get it ..many of you loved Van Halen ….and the one time I met he was nice ….and he was talented …meh to me means I don’t care that much ….and I don’t …doesn’t mean he wasn’t good, he was but not for me.”

More recently, he again addressed the issue by tweeting: “You will be happy to know that I am reliably informed by the younger members of my family that I am an old idiot and Van Halen was one of the next guitarists to have ever lived.”

When someone told him he “blew the whole Eddie Van Halen thing”, Crosby replied with: “I did. He was an amazing guitarist but I didn’t know that. Truth is I never ever listened to that band so I was completely ignorant. No insult intended. I never listened to any of the big pop rock bands. I didn’t even own a Led Zep record and they could write.”
